About this Role We’re looking for a
Dining Room Supervisor
in Independent Living who thrives on creating memorable dining experiences for our residents. In this role, you’ll lead a team of
8–10 servers
during meal service, making sure everything runs smoothly—from seating guests with a smile to supporting servers throughout service.
Our dining shifts are steady and predictable.
Shift:
Evening Shift 11:00am – 7:00pm.
What You’ll Do
Team up with the Dining Room Manager to organize reservations, private parties, and special events.
Meet with the culinary crew to stay in the loop on menu changes.
Help with desserts and light food prep.
Assign server stations and keep the team on track.
Keep the dining room sparkling before and after service.
Greet and seat residents & guests with efficiency and warmth.
Jump in to support servers whenever needed.
Assist residents with reservations, takeout orders, and questions.
Use our touchscreen Point of Sale system for meal counts, reservations, and charges.
Make sure all side work is completed before servers clock out.

What We’re Looking For
High school diploma or equivalent.
At least
1 year of supervisory or lead server experience
in a fine restaurant, country club, hotel, retirement community, or similar.Strong communication skills—you can explain menus, answer questions, and handle requests with ease.
A people‑person who can empathize, connect, and work well with residents, families, staff, and leadership.
State‑required health/alcohol compliance card.
Ability to pass a pre‑employment drug screen and background check.
Physical Requirements / Working Conditions Light to moderate physical effort 90% of the time. Must be able to stand and walk 90% of the work day; ability to stoop, bend and stretch frequently; must be able to lift up to 50 pounds frequently. Must be able to see, hear, and speak.
Job Details Job Type:
Full‑time
Shift:
Evening Shift 11:00am – 7:00pm
Salary:
$19.00 per hour
